I'm on my fifth pair AE boots (3 HM's, 1 Freeport, and these Carters)... These Carters do not disappoint. The most notable difference are the excellent Itshide Commando soles and the stiffer yet very nice leather. The soles are lower profile lugs, very solid, and look dressier than other lug soles. Not sure what leather this is but it is stiffer than CXL or the other leathers I own... possibly a pull-up leather? There is padded tongue compared to HM's. They respond to Saphir Renovator conditioner very nicely. Sizing and comfort seem consistent with my other AE's. They'll need some breaking-in compared to my HM's but are still pretty comfortable out of the box for me. Very solid, cool-looking boot.

Very quality boot and pecan leather is absolutely gorgeous. Could not be happier with the quality and construction of this boot and the sole is excellent, when I recraft my Higgins mill I'm switching to this sole. Never tried this last before, it's a bit narrow. Sizing note: I ordered a 10.5 3e in the Carter and wear a 10.5e in the Higgins mill. My 10.5e Higgins mill feels roomier than my carters.

I love all the colors but have Pecan. A little hard to put on/take off without unlacing the top eyelets. I personally much prefer the "hidden" Commando sole to Dainite, which I think can be very slippery on a wet floor. I can hike in these and dress them up. Leather is durable. Some reviews said runs narrow but this was not my experience. Very comfortable if still a little heavy.
